func env(key, fallback string) string {
if v := strings.TrimSpace(os.Getenv(key)); v != "" {
return v
}
return fallback
}
func boolean(key string, fallback bool) bool {
raw := strings.TrimSpace(os.Getenv(key))
if raw == "" {
return fallback
}
value, err := strconv.ParseBool(raw)
if err != nil {
return fallback
}
return value
}
func duration(key string, fallback time.Duration) time.Duration {
raw := strings.TrimSpace(os.Getenv(key))
if raw == "" {
return fallback
}
if d, err := time.ParseDuration(raw); err == nil {
return d
}
// Bare numbers are read as seconds, which is friendlier in a compose file.
if secs, err := strconv.Atoi(raw); err == nil {
return time.Duration(secs) * time.Second
}
return fallback
}
